We’re seeking an inspiring Head of Product Design - Sports to lead our forward-thinking design team at Super.
This strategic role combines vision, hands-on creativity, and leadership to shape the end-to-end customer experience across our sports betting platforms. You will translate company goals and customer needs into compelling design strategies that differentiate our products, foster user engagement, and extend our market reach.
We're looking for someone who:
- Leadership experience: 12+ years of proven success managing and developing product design teams, particularly in regulated or complex environments such as sports betting, gaming, and/or other sectors such as entertainment or e-commerce.
- Mastery of design craft: Demonstrable portfolio showcasing UX, UI, interaction, and visual design impact, along with tangible results that improved user engagement and business metrics.
- Strategic and tactical agility: Ability to think big-picture while managing daily deliverables—balancing long-term innovation with immediate product needs.
- Exceptional communication skills: Influence and build trust with senior stakeholders, articulate design decisions clearly, and foster collaborative relationships across teams and regions.
- Hands-on expertise: Deep familiarity with modern tools like Figma, FullStory, Marvin, User Testing, also including working with design systems, accessibility principles, user research, and inclusive design practices.
- Global perspective: Experience designing for diverse markets, understanding regional behaviors, and regulatory landscapes.
- Data-driven approach: Comfort navigating analytics platforms, leveraging insights to inform design strategies, and continuously optimize user experiences.
- Industry knowledge: Familiarity with sports betting features, regulations, and user behaviors, enabling the creation of compliant yet engaging experiences.

About Super
We are a global technology group, dedicated to building the future of entertainment and fan-centric experiences. With commercial markets in Brazil, Belgium, Poland, Romania, Greece, and Serbia, and a network of offices across Spain, Croatia, Malta, Gibraltar, the Netherlands, and the UK, we are a truly international organization. Our purpose at Super has evolved from sports and betting into creating the platform that stretches into the wider world of technology-driven entertainment. With a growing and diverse team of more than 5,000 people, we create immersive, responsible, and personalized experiences for millions of customers worldwide.
